Covaris Receives the Society for Laboratory Automation and Screening (SLAS) New Product Award at LabAutomation 2011


WOBURN, Mass.- The Covaris® LE220(TM) high performance ultra-sonicator has received the prestigious SLAS New Product Award at the LabAutomation 2011 conference in Palm Springs CA. With over 4,400 attendees, LabAuto is the premier laboratory automation conference and exhibition, bringing science, technology, and industry together.

Breakthrough products introduced at LabAutomation are evaluated by a team of industry experts. Each year, the best and most promising new products are recognized with the SLAS New Product Award. Covaris is very pleased to announce that for 2011, the LE220 is a recipient of the New Product Award designation.

The LE220 was chosen for the New Product Award from more than 400 LabAutomation 2011 exhibitors, based on its technical originality, anticipated impact on the field of laboratory automation, supporting data that reflects universal scientific methodology, and market demand. The LE220 Ultra-sonicator

The LE220 is specifically designed for high-throughput, parallel-processing operations utilizing the Covaris Adaptive Focused Acoustic(TM) (AFA(TM)) technology. The LE220 is ideal for next-gen nucleic acid sequencing, compound dissolution, tissue/cell lysis applications, and other high-throughput applications. With DNA shearing performance characteristics matching industry-standard Covaris S-series and E-series instruments, the LE220 reproducibly shears DNA to desired lengths, in a multi-sample parallel-processing mode. The LE220 is designed to improve sample processing throughput 8 fold over single sample methods in a 96 tube format (32 fold in a 384 well format).

About Covaris, Inc.

Covaris, Inc. provides advanced sample preparation systems for life and analytical science. Our sample prep technologies support a wide variety of applications including next-generation DNA sequencing, ChIP, proteomics, and compound management. Our patented Adaptive Focused Acoustic (AFA) technology enables a high energy density to bring unsurpassed speed and efficiency to biological and chemical sample preparation. The AFA process, based on shock wave physics, delivers controlled, precise, and accurate energy to biological and chemical samples

About SLAS

Founded in 1996, SLAS is a worldwide organization providing leadership and educational benefits on the utilization of automation technologies, robotics, and artificial intelligence in order to improve the quality, efficiency, and relevance of laboratory analysis within and across multiple industries. Laboratory Automation includes podium presentations, poster sessions, and exhibiting companies from all over the world showcasing the latest in laboratory automation technologies.
